- Is there an App for the Garmin 1030 that will allow you to control Hive Smart home devices. Would like to turn heating on when out on bike
I suggest you to take a look on the home-assistant.io page. This is a SW package to manage your home with specific devices that you can assemble or purchase. This software has many feature such as when you are X km far from your home it switch on light or switch on aircondition etc. But actually any event can manage anything which is connected to this SW. As far as I see from the webpage HIVE Smart Home devices can be connected too to the home-assistant. So no need to take phone out of pocket neither gloves off. If Hive supports IFTTT / IoT there's a couple of ciq apps that can trigger applets.
Apps however cannot be used whilst recording an activity only widgets can do that. There is one ciq widget that can do that on the Edge 1030 called IoTclient widget. I've tried it & it does work though the UI isn't the best
I have Tuya Smartlife & use a widget on my fenix 6 that I use to control my 2 most important things via IFTTT.. . Heating & Espresso machine.
